3.3. Работа с credientials.json

Данный файл содержит в себе настройки используемые в разных функциях сервиса. И лучше всего сделать все настройки сразу, чем добавлять потом.

Изначально данный файл (credientials.json) выглядит так:
{
"username": "",
"password": "",
"services": {
"anti-captcha.com": "",
"vk.com": {
"appId": ""
},
"cacheFlushInterval": 0,
"proxy": {
"proxyReboot": "",
"proxyRebootPause": 0
},
"telegram": {
"botToken": "",
"chatId": ""
},
"https://sms-activate.org": {
"key": ""
}
}
}

  1. Автоматическая авторизация в расширения.
    Для того чтобы не вводить во все расширения логин и пароль от кабинета можно указать их сразу в этом файле. В дальнейшем при использовании авторизация в расширение будет производиться автоматически.
    "username": "[email protected]",
    "password": "dhjdfh22fjkd",

2. Антикапча для работы с VK.COM
Для безперебойной работы с социальной сетью VK.COM следует указать апи ключ от сервиса https://anti-captcha.com и добавить ключ приложения для работы с апи Вконтакте.
"services": {
"anti-captcha.com": "jhhfjhgjgh744jkrj28344jke",
"vk.com": {
"appId": "2332334874278723"
},

3. Настройка интервала очистки кэша браузера.
Кэш браузера может очищаться двумя способами — выполнением действия ClearCache или выставлением таймера в данной настройке.
Интервал задается в секундах. По прошествии этого времени кэш будет очищаться.
«cacheFlushInterval»: 22400,

4. Автоматический ребут мобильной прокси при авторизации.
Для многих, кто работает с мобильными проксями важно менять ИП адрес при массовой авторизации аккаунтов. Для этого была введена данная настройка, которая позволяет ребутить прокси по ссылке тем самым меняя её ИП адрес. Введите сюда ссылку на ребут и всё будет работать. Также можно настроить паузу после ребута, если для ребута прокси требуется более длительное время, чем 10-15 секунд
"proxy": {
"proxyReboot": "https://ltespace.com/ch477462",
"proxyRebootPause": 0
},

5. Настройка вывода информации в бота Телеграм
Для того чтобы воспользоваться этой функцией, вам необходимо создать своего бота телеграм и прописать настройки.

  1. Создаем бота телеграм. Переходим в бота @BotFather
    создаете бота по шагам. Нам нужен будет название бота и токен
  2. Узнаем ид этого бота. Переходим в бота @username_to_id_bot и отправляем ему свой логин в формате @moyTg. В ответ он даст нам наш ид.
  3. Переходим в нашего созданного бота и отправляем команду /start
  4. Конфигурируем файл расширения credentials.json добавляя туда
"telegram": {        
"botToken": "1955124156:AAFQDsVQeY4444Y17Xt6XIF6ctDS4R_DI",        "chatId": "186444492"    
}

6. Настройка апи ключа сервиса sms-activate.ru
Если вы планируете пользоваться функцией Registration, то вам нужно будет добавить в данный файл АПИ ключ сервиса sms-activate.ru. Взять его можно перейдя по ссылке https://sms-activate.ru/ru/profile . Добавляем этот ключ следующим образом:
"sms-activate.org": {
"key": "jkdjgdghndgodfoijiofdjeirieoirioe"
}


7. Настройка апи ключа сервиса onlinesim.ru
Если вы планируете пользоваться функцией Registration, то вам нужно будет добавить в данный файл АПИ ключ сервиса sms-activate.ru. Взять его можно перейдя по ссылке https://sms-activate.ru/ru/profile . Добавляем этот ключ следующим образом:
"onlinesim.ru": {
"key": "fdfddffdfdhgjdflkdfldkjfir"
}


8. Настройка апи ключа сервиса vak-sms.com
Если вы планируете пользоваться функцией Registration, то вам нужно будет добавить в данный файл АПИ ключ сервиса sms-activate.ru. Взять его можно перейдя по ссылке https://sms-activate.ru/ru/profile . Добавляем этот ключ следующим образом:
"vak-sms.com": {
"key": "d45ddgf5gjdflkdfldkjfir"
}

В итоге после всех настроек у вас должен получиться примерно такой файл:

{
	"username": "[email protected]",
	"password": "67655wMlzT",
    "services": {
        "anti-captcha.com": "hdgjhdfjdhksdjksdcj",
        "vk.com": {
            "appId": "46374746626737"
        },
        "cacheFlushInterval": 0,
        "proxy": {
            "proxyReboot": "https://ltespace.com/ch477462",
            "proxyRebootPause": 0
        },
		"telegram": {        
		"botToken": "5074265230:AAEyEMkXCYqDkKpciNX2XHs8RhFFoUj6RQ4",
		"chatId": "401071458"
        },
        "sms-activate.org": {
            "key": "dhjfhdjfhgjdflkdfldkjfir"
        },
"onlinesim.ru": {
            "key": "fdfddffdfdhgjdflkdfldkjfir"
        },
"vak-sms.com": {
            "key": "d45ddgf5gjdflkdfldkjfir"
        }
    }
}


Итак, все важные настройки вы прописали в файл credientials.json и можете заменить им файл находящийся в расширении по умолчанию.